Volleyball Announces 2010 Signees
COLUMBIA, S.C. - The Columbia College volleyball program announced the signing of three players for next season’s team. Jacqui Anderson of Brea, CA, Shelby Foster of Graniteville, SC and Lauren Sorrells of Sumter, SC will compete for the Fighting Koalas in the fall.
Jacqui Anderson, a setter from Brea Olinda High School, was a 1st team All-Century league performer her senior season. This past club season she played for the Saddleback Valley Volleyball Club 18 – Ki team that finished 7th at the 2010 Volleyball Festival in Phoenix, AZ. Anderson will major in early childhood education. Head coach Brian Solomon said, “Jacqui is a great person to have joining our program. She has been successful at a very high level in club, which will help her make the transition to college and she is a fun person to be around.”
Shelby Foster is a 5-11 middle blocker from Midland Valley High School. Foster, an all-region player, is no stranger to coach Solomon, who coached her during the club season with Magnum Volleyball Club based out of Columbia, SC. Coach Solomon said, “Shelby has great length and vision for the game. Her blocking will definitely be an asset.” Foster will major in journalism at Columbia College.
Lauren Sorrells comes to Columbia College from Sumter High School where she was a right side hitter. Sorrells will learn several roles, competing on the right side and as a defensive specialist. Another education major, Lauren plans to major in middle education with a math certification.
The 2010 recruiting class will join 12 returners from last year’s team that finished 24-9 overall. Coach Solomon commented, “We have added three quality individuals who are all a great fit for Columbia College. We have added depth with quality players who will help us become more competitive in the SSAC.” The Koalas’ volleyball team will open the season at home against Johnson and Wales University on August 28th, at 2:00pm.
